Please read the entire description as this B-Team will be different than others.

We all know that when trouble strikes the townsfolk will reach out to their local team of legendary adventurers who always manage to save the day. But what if those amazing adventurers are off on another quest? What if they can’t leave town at the moment due to important family obligations? What if that party all ate the clams from the sketchy tavern in the bad part of town and are down with some serious food poisoning? That’s when the town puts their fate in the hands of the best of the rest, the okay-est of the bad options left to them, the very last resort: The B-Team. This is a night for you to play a slightly less competent adventurer. Somebody who might really want to consider a career as a cook or maybe a librarian or something along those lines. You will need to create two level three characters for this event. One will be your starting character, the other will be a backup, you know, just in case… There are rules for character creation which you will have to follow, you can find them here: https://torontodnd.com/events/bteam

In this B-Team game, you will all be playing Children (could be adult children) and your characters have loving mothers, who are alive! Unfortunately, your characters' mothers have recently disappeared and it is your job to find them and bring them back.

As it says at the top +1s are more than welcome. I would like to encourage you to bring someone, a family member (maybe your Mom) or a close friend who isn't familiar with D&D. The person familiar with D&D will play using the standard B-Team rules while your +1 can use my special B-Team Array (14 ,13 ,11 ,10 ,9 ,7) and assign it as they, please! (Please note you must create the character sheet and give an impromptu introduction for the family member or friend. I will do an additional introduction and will help if needed (feel free to message me for help) but 50% of the teaching is on you)

The first Dungeons & Dragons game was played back when Gary Gygax and Dave Arneson chose to personalize the massive battles of their fantasy wargames with the exploits of individual heroes. This inspiration became the first fantasy roleplaying game, in which players are characters in an ongoing fantasy story. This new kind of game has become immensely popular over the years, and D&D has grown to include many new ways to vividly experience worlds of heroic fantasy. The core of D&D is storytelling. You and your friends may tell a story together, guiding your heroes through quests for treasure, battles with deadly foes, daring rescues, courtly intrigue, and much more. You can also explore the many worlds of D&D through any of the hundreds of novels written by today's hottest fantasy authors, as well as engaging board games and immersive video games. All of these stories are part of D&D.
